Planting Calendar for Salsify

Frost tolerance for salsify: Tolerant of a very small amount of frost.
When to plant: Up to 3 weeks before last frost.

Salsify do ok in moderate cold which means that you can start planting them slightly earlier than other frost tender plants.

The earliest that you can plant salsify in Salem is March. However, you really should wait until April if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ant salsify and expect a good harvest is probably August. If you wait any later than that and your salsify may not have a chance to grow to maturity. You can get started a few weeks earlier by starting your salsify indoors.

Last Frost Date

On average the last frost when the weather gets warmer is on April 15 in Salem. In the coldest months of winter you can expect an average low temperature of -10°F.

Since the USDA zone info for Salem is an average the actual date of last frost changes from year to year. Since half of the time in Salem you get surprised by a frost after April 15 be ready to cover your salsify in the event of a late frost.
